Layan Beach – A Peaceful Hidden Gem in Phuket

Layan Beach is one of Phuket’s most peaceful and underrated beaches, located at the northern end of Bang Tao Beach. Surrounded by lush greenery and protected by a small island offshore, Layan offers a calm and relaxing atmosphere, making it ideal for travelers who want to escape the crowds.

Unlike more popular beaches such as Patong or Kata, Layan Beach remains quiet and natural, perfect for those seeking tranquility and privacy.


Why Visit Layan Beach

Layan Beach is known for its soft golden sand, shallow waters, and laid-back vibe. The beach is part of a protected national park area, which helps preserve its natural beauty and keeps it less developed than other parts of Phuket.

The water here is generally calm, making it suitable for swimming, especially during the high season. The surrounding pine trees provide shade, creating a comfortable environment for long beach days.

Walk to the Small Island

During low tide, you can walk across the shallow water to the small island located just offshore. It is a unique experience and a great spot for photos.

How to Get to Layan Beach

Layan Beach is located about 30 minutes from Phuket International Airport and is easily accessible by car or motorbike. It sits at the northern end of Bang Tao Beach, within the Laguna Phuket area.

Parking is available near the beach, and access is convenient for visitors staying in nearby resorts.


Best Time to Visit

The best time to visit Layan Beach is from November to April when the sea is calm and the weather is sunny. During the low season, waves can be stronger, and swimming may be limited.
